Common Ramset Gate Technician Problems in Apple Valley

🔧 Intermittent Ramset Operator Stoppages

Your Ramset operator abruptly halts mid-cycle, necessitating a manual restart. Potential causes include a failing control board, a faulty limit switch, or a subtle obstruction missed by the safety sensors.

🔧 Ramset Gate Won't Close Fully

The gate starts to close but halts before reaching its fully closed state, or it reverses without warning. This frequently points to problems with the encoder, the safety obstruction detection mechanism, or a physical binding point within the gate track.

🔧 Ramset Gate Operator Making Unusual Noises

Unusual grinding, squealing, or clicking noises originating from the Ramset operator while it's running. These sounds typically indicate worn internal gears, track misalignment, or a failing motor bearing that requires prompt service.

🔧 Ramset Gate Control Panel Errors

Error codes displayed on the Ramset control panel, rendering the system inoperable. These specific codes reveal internal diagnostic information and demand a trained technician's expertise to interpret and rectify the root cause.

🔧 Ramset Gate Fails to Respond to Remote or Keypad

The gate operator fails to respond when activated by its remote control, keypad, or integrated access system. This issue can arise from a defective receiver, depleted remote batteries, or a communication breakdown between the main control board and input devices.

Maintenance Tips for Apple Valley Properties

🛠️ Regular Obstruction Checks
Regularly clear the gate's operational path of any accumulating debris, rocks, or plant growth. Verify that safety sensors remain free from high desert dust and other blockages to avoid false triggers and service interruptions.
🛠️ Listen for Abnormal Sounds
Heed any novel or atypical sounds produced during your gate's operation. Grinding, persistent squealing, or distinct clunking often signal an emerging mechanical problem that warrants immediate investigation.
🛠️ Inspect for Visible Wear
Conduct visual inspections of the gate's track, rollers, and motor housing for any indications of damage, corrosion from the elements, or excessive wear. Resolving minor imperfections early can prevent them from developing into expensive repairs.

Can extreme heat in Apple Valley affect my Ramset gate's performance?+
Yes, the extreme heat in Apple Valley can significantly affect Ramset gate operators. Prolonged exposure to high temperatures can cause overheating of the motor and electronics, leading to intermittent operation or complete shutdown. It can also accelerate the degradation of rubber seals and plastic components. Our trained technicians understand these environmental impacts.

My Ramset gate is making a grinding noise. What could be the cause?+
A grinding noise from your Ramset gate operator usually indicates a mechanical problem. This could be worn or damaged gears within the motor unit, a misaligned track, or issues with the rollers.
